Overall objectives

.To deliver timely, accurate, and actionable insights through structured reporting on system health, performance, availability, and incidents.

.To translate technical observability data into meaningful reports and dashboards that support IT leadership, operations, and business decision-making.

.To measure key reliability and operational metrics (e.g., MTTR, MTTD, uptime, SLA/SLO compliance) and provide performance transparency.

.To support a data-driven culture of continuous improvement within I&O by surfacing trends, anomalies, and recurring issues.

Role specific responsibilities

.Develop, automate, and maintain dashboards and reports that track observability metrics, infrastructure health, and incident KPIs.

.Produce executive-level summaries, operational scorecards, and trend analyses to support strategic planning and performance reviews.

.Align reporting outputs to key IT service management objectives, including reliability, responsiveness, availability, and customer impact.

.Work closely with observability domain specialists to translate technical data (logs, traces, metrics) into usable business insights.

.Track and report on SLO/SLI performance, supporting site reliability goals and early-warning indicators.

.Support capacity planning and forecasting using infrastructure and incident data.

.Enable teams with self-service analytics, metric definitions, and report training sessions.

General functional responsibilities

.Ensure the accuracy, completeness, and consistency of telemetry-based data used in all reporting.

.Maintain a central reporting repository and consistent data dictionary for operational metrics.

.Participate in incident reviews and post-mortems to extract learnings and quantify business impact.

.Collaborate with I&O, DevOps, PMO, and service management teams to evolve reporting frameworks.

.Ensure reporting solutions meet regulatory, compliance, and audit requirements for availability and performance reporting.

.Continuously improve reporting methodologies, automation, and visualisation capabilities.

Qualifications

Core competencies required

.Proficient in tools like Power BI, Tableau, Grafana, Looker, or Kibana.

.Strong understanding of data pipelines, ETL processes, and integrations with observability platforms (e.g., Splunk, Dynatrace, Datadog, ServiceNow).

.Deep knowledge of operational KPIs such as MTTR, MTBF, alert volume trends, incident frequency, SLA/SLO adherence, system uptime, and ticket ageing.

.Ability to identify trends, correlations, and anomalies from large sets of time-series and event data.

.Strong written and verbal communication skills for delivering insights to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.

.Highly detail-oriented, disciplined in version control and documentation of reporting logic.

.Skilled in stakeholder engagement and requirements gathering.
